Output 65303c3afc6323b0b8567c5969fc562e8d026c7a75ca3290160ed126e4aa0c24:4

value
12530762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e708019ea859601d33cedd77cfb47c2989322ad6 OP_EQUAL
address
3Nkbc9RDJeyGZWcXcDfRKqrxE28RqsGEBX
transaction
65303c3afc6323b0b8567c5969fc562e8d026c7a75ca3290160ed126e4aa0c24
spent
true